August 5, 1927, Hillsboro, Oregon ~
October 7, 2011, Portland, Oregon
Ethel Mae Adams was born in Hillsboro, Oregon to parents Lorin and Gwendolyn (Davies) McCormick. She grew up on the family farm in Newberg, Oregon. In 1953, she married Ralph E. Adams and they made their home in Portland, Oregon. She was a homemaker, day care provider, and past president of the Portland Day Care Association. She enjoyed gardening, cooking, Bunco, trips to the Oregon Coast, and caring for others. Her family always came first. Ethel is survived by her children; David, Annette, Barbara, Carolyn, and Richard; ten grandchildren; three great-grandchildren; and a sister, Eva Paul. She was predeceased by her husband, Ralph; parents Lorin and Gwen; and sisters Paulene and Irene.
